每页更改背景图像访问jquery cookies

时间:2013-04-02 23:55:01

标签: javascript jquery cookies

我想在每次用户访问网站时更改背景图片。我假设这可以通过jquery cookie插件实现,但我只找到了在一定时间后可以更改图像的实例,而不是每次用户访问页面时。

关于如何实现这个或教程的任何想法你们都知道我很感激。

3 个答案:

答案 0 :(得分:0)

如果长话谈话最好的方式是服务器端。将他们的IP地址记录到数据库中,然后每次有人访问该页面时进行检查。如果他们已经在那里然后加载新图像否则加载第一个图像和丢失的人IP地址。

答案 1 :(得分:0)

假设您有一系列可能的图像,您可以将当前图像索引存储在cookie中。页面加载时,从cookie中获取当前图像索引并以模数增加模数。如果它为null,则将其设置为零。然后在此新索引处显示图像并将其值存储在cookie中。

答案 2 :(得分:0)

  

我只找到了在一段时间后可以更改图像的实例

假设您有五种不同的背景图像: 1 =>狗,2 =>当用户访问该页面时,您为其分配了值为1的cookie,这意味着:此用户已经看过狗。当他再次访问时:检查cookie。获取数字,增量,显示猫并使用新数字重置cookie(2)。